Plan to hike solo from Alice to Mt Sonder/Redback gorge.
Anyone know what hitching would be like get back to Alice from the Western trail end?
Solo transport with a tour company $370 about the as the Melbourne Alice air ticket

It worked for me. I walked from Rwetyepme back out to Glen Helen, got a ride within ten minutes to the Ormiston turnoff, and the vehicle about to pull onto the highway as I was getting out of the first car gave me a ride all the way back. It can be a bit hit and miss, but people - locals especially - tend to stop when you're that far from civilisation.

I hitched a ride from Ellery Creek back to Alice in August. It was so easy. Literally within 5 minutes of getting to the main road, we had a lift back the whole way. Offered to contribute to petrol but they didn't want it.
Very easy.
